Integrating therapeutic approaches into online care

Monica uses several well-established methods to guide online work, blending practical tools with reflective exploration.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) focuses on identifying and changing unhelpful thought and behavior patterns; it is often useful for anxiety, depression, stress, and mood symptoms. Client-Centered Therapy emphasizes empathic listening and collaboration, helping people clarify values and build on their own strengths while fostering a respectful therapeutic relationship. Emotionally-Focused Therapy (EFT) concentrates on understanding and reshaping emotional responses, which can be helpful for relationship distress and processing attachment-related concerns.
